Major Scales Triads • You can build a triad on every note in a major scale just by using the notes in the scale.
Major Scales Triads • These chords are identified by roman numerals OR by the name of the scale degree the triad is built on.
Roman numerals • Upper case roman numerals are used for major chords (i. e. I, IV, V) • Lower case roman numerals are used for minor chords (i. e. ii, iii, vi) • The seventh chord is a diminished chord and is represented with lower case roman numerals and a circle. (i. e. vii◦)
The Primary Triads Only three chords from the major scale are Major. They are the I chord or the tonic, the IV chord or the subdominant, and the V chord or the dominant. These are called the primary chords. Many folk, pop, and classical songs just use these three chords.

Listen to the Primary Triads: 12 Bar Blues • One of the most popular chord progressions in popular music. • Uses the primary triads: I, IV, V VARIATION: Roman-numeral notation: I I IV IV I I V V I I I IV IV I I
